Subject: [net-next 03/13] i40e: remove unnecessary call to i40e_update_link_info

This call is made just prior to running i40e_link_event. In
i40e_link_event, we set hw->phy.get_link_info to true just prior to
calling i40e_get_link_status, which conveniently runs
i40e_update_link_info for us. Thus, we are running i40e_update_link_info
twice, which seems like something we don't need to do...

dr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c | 1 -
1 file changed, 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c
index e9335af4cc28..a6dca5822cff 100644
--- a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c
+++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c
@@ -10761,7 +10761,6 @@ static int i40e_setup_pf_switch(struct i40e_pf *pf, bool reinit)
i40e_pf_config_rss(pf);
/* fill in link information and enable LSE reporting */
- i40e_update_link_info(&pf->hw);
i40e_link_event(pf);
/* Initialize user-specific link properties */
